The Chancellor has published “Fixing the Foundations: Creating a more prosperous nation”, a comprehensive plan that sets the agenda for the whole of government over the parliament to reverse the UK’s long-term productivity problem and secure rising living standards and a better quality of life for our citizens.
Secretary of State for Business, Sajid Javid, launched the plan at a Speech at Birmingham, saying: “Narrowing this gap is a prize worth striving for. For instance, matching the productivity of the US would raise GDP by 31%, equating to around £21,000 per annum for every household in the UK. The government’s framework for raising productivity includes 15 key areas, built around two pillars: first, encouraging long term investment, and secondly, promoting a dynamic economy”.
